About Me
Dr. Murtaza K. Adam is a vitreoretinal surgeon at Colorado Retina Associates who treats the full range of medical and surgical retina conditions for adults. In addition to common diseases such as mac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y, and retinal vein occlusions, he has special expertise in managing complications of cataract surgery, dislocated intraocular lenses, and complex anterior–posterior segment reconstruction. Patients describe his care as meticulous, evidence-based, and collaborative.
A Wisconsin native, Dr. Adam completed both ophthalmology residency and vitreoretinal surgery fellowship at Wills Eye Hospital, where he served as co-chief resident and received the William Tasman Outstanding Fellow Award. His research and education activities include more than 40 peer-reviewed publications and over 100 abstracts, with interests spanning SFIOL techniques, tele-ophthalmology, novel imaging, and ocular infectious disease.
